如何使用CheckBox控制Button的Disabled属性?
在网页中需要实现用CheckBox控制按钮的激活状态。也就是说当勾选时激活按钮,取消勾选时使按钮不可用。自己编了段代码,可是无法正常运行。具体情况是:*初始状态下“注册”...
在网页中需要实现用CheckBox控制按钮的激活状态。也就是说当勾选时激活按钮,取消勾选时使按钮不可用。自己编了段代码,可是无法正常运行。具体情况是:
* 初始状态下“注册”按钮不可用,CheckBox保持未勾选状态。
* 当第一次勾选CheckBox时,可以激活“注册”按钮。可是以后无论是否取消勾选,“注册”按钮始终保持可用状态。
* 我想达到的效果是勾选时激活按钮,取消勾选时使按钮不可用。
具体代码如下,不知道是什么地方的问题。请高手指教。
<input name="ChkAgree" type="checkbox" class="buttom" id="ChkAgree" onclick="CheckAgreeState()" value="CheckBoxSelected" />
<script language="JavaScript" type="text/javascript">
function CheckAgreeState() {
if (FormRegiste.ChkAgree.Checked)
{
FormRegiste.SubmitButton.disabled=true
}
else
{
FormRegiste.SubmitButton.disabled=false
}
}
</script> 展开
* 初始状态下“注册”按钮不可用,CheckBox保持未勾选状态。
* 当第一次勾选CheckBox时,可以激活“注册”按钮。可是以后无论是否取消勾选,“注册”按钮始终保持可用状态。
* 我想达到的效果是勾选时激活按钮,取消勾选时使按钮不可用。
具体代码如下,不知道是什么地方的问题。请高手指教。
<input name="ChkAgree" type="checkbox" class="buttom" id="ChkAgree" onclick="CheckAgreeState()" value="CheckBoxSelected" />
<script language="JavaScript" type="text/javascript">
function CheckAgreeState() {
if (FormRegiste.ChkAgree.Checked)
{
FormRegiste.SubmitButton.disabled=true
}
else
{
FormRegiste.SubmitButton.disabled=false
}
}
</script> 展开
1个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询